Additional Fees
$42 USD PER DAY MANDATORY RESORT FEE, INCLUDES:
• Refreshing custom welcome cocktail
• Access to exclusive world-class entertainment experiences
• Access to state-of-the-art elite fitness facility
• Daily housekeeping and nightly turndown service
• Convenient and environmentally-friendly on-resort transportation
• Complimentary Wi-Fi Internet
• Unlimited free local calls
• Personal safe for secure storage
As of June 3, 2025, the resort fees include additional special benefits for ThirdHome members. Please inquire with the Member Experience team for more details.
NOTE: Resort Fees, if paid up front, are non-refundable.
ADDITIONAL FEES
• Valet parking: $110 MXN per night, $540 MXN per week ($32 USD per week)
• A government-imposed lodging tax (5%). ($4 on average per night)
OPTIONAL FEE
• Airport to Hotel Shuttle Service (one way): $14 USD per passenger (adult or child) - shuttle service must be secured with at least 5 days' notice prior to arrival
Please note that the resort fees and additional fees are subject to change.

Places of Interest
- Puerto Vallarta Malecón - Take a walk along Puerto Vallarta’s boardwalk filled with shops and restaurants looking out onto Banderas Bay.
- Nearby, you'll find a collection of intriguing towns to explore, from surfer-chic Sayulita to the charming mountain village of San Sebastian. The spirited city of Puerto Vallarta has added dynamic attractions to its traditional charms.
- Almaverde Farm - Take a tour of this 40-acre farm yielding over 65 types of fruits and vegetables that are used throughout Vidanta Nuevo Vallarta.
- Banderas Bay is the seventh-largest natural bay in the world, and considered to be among the most naturally endowed waters in the Americas. Nesting turtles in summer and whales in winter, it is an aquatic playground!

July 2025Some great features, and some need for improvement
There were many things that I liked about this resort, but unfortunately there were also some things that I did not like. The rooms are nice, but they are in need of updating and the housekeeping was hit and miss. One of the most annoying things about Vidanta is the enormity of the resort. It is like a jungle maze and it takes forever to get anywhere either by shuttle or foot. Also, non of the staff know there way around, and they would regularly give us wrong direction on how to reach common areas such as the beach or the gym. If you are not interested in getting a minimum of 10K steps a day just to get to the pool or beach, I would skip this one. Also, they make it very challenging to leave the resort, so if you want to spend time in town, this is not the place to stay. ”
